Hey Lovely! In today’s episode, we’re taking a beautiful journey through both the science and the history of homemaking—and why the simple rhythm of cleaning your home once a week has endured for thousands of years.
We’ll talk about: ✨ how dust, bacteria, and clutter naturally build up within a 7–10 day cycle ✨ what modern neuroscience says about clutter and cortisol ✨ why every-other-week cleaning feels heavier, harder, and more stressful ✨ the biblical and historical roots of weekly rhythms ✨ how ancient homemakers, medieval households, Victorian women, and even 1950s homemakers all lived in weekly patterns ✨ what these rhythms can look like today—grace-filled, flexible, and aligned with real life
You’ll walk away with a deeper understanding of why weekly rhythms work, and how they can bring more peace, beauty, and stability to your home—without perfection or overwhelm.
